Rainwater Harvesting Systems provides an environmentally sustainable plumbing service that involves the design and installation of systems to gather, hold, and utilize rainwater for non-potable purposes. These systems typically include storage tanks, catchment areas, and filters, supporting sustainable water use in gardening, sanitation, and general cleaning. Properly implemented systems lower utility costs and promote water conservation
